2007 Lord of the Fork Race

    The 2007 Lord of the Fork Race saw more racers this year than ever before, and a very fast field. If you didn’t finish in less than 12 minutes, you didn’t even make the top 20! We had 35 racers in all, beautiful weather and fall colors, and a huge group providing rescue support and filming video (mostly the local KY crowd).
    A big surprise this year was the arrival of the new LL race boat, although the boat doesn’t matter near as much as the driver. Toby MacDermott proved once again that he is the man to beat on this river. This is 3 wins in a row, and his fastest time yet. 10:27 puts him only 10 seconds away from Tommy Hilleke’s fastest time several years ago. (The race record is still 9:53 in a Wavehopper by Chris Hipgrave in ‘96).
    The margin for the win this year was only 1 second. Geoff Calhoun showed up and blitzed the course, only his second weekend riding this river. Watch out for him next year, he doesn’t like second place!
    Third place was Matt Walker in his retro T-Slalom and an even older spray skirt. I think the boat stays dry only because the water doesn’t have time to leak in. This was his personal record as well, at 10:43, edging out Adam Herzog by 1 second. Rounding out the top 5 was Bryan Kirk.
    Robin Betz was once again the fastest woman on the course, even with a little speedbump in Maze. She holds the women’s course record and is now the women’s champ 4 years running. Katie Buddenburg made a strong showing as well, and was much faster than her time suggests. Her run was interrupted in the last 50 yards by a rude awakening against a rock wall. Such is life, I’m sure we’ll see her again next year with an eye for the win.
    Kirk Williams was the fastest (and only) hand paddler this year, somehow guiding the Tornado through the course with expert skill.
    The C-1 record finally fell. I’ve been chasing Andy Bridge’s time of 11:23 for the past few years, and this year the flatwater and upriver training sessions finally paid off. My time of 10:57 was just barely in the top 10 overall though. The boat is over 25 years old, very fragile glass, and I didn’t show it any mercy on the rocky lines. Like Neil Young says, it’s better to burn out than to fade away. Will Lyons was also looking fast in his Cascade. (And both of us are always fearing that Bernie is going to enter the race and show us how its really done.)
    One of our veteran racers had a spectacular wreck just above the finish line, broaching at the lip of the Box, falling in backwards, into the wall, and then swam like hell for the finish. And of course it’s all on film!
    I’m sure there’s more stories out there from the race, lots of new faces and some personal rivalries that are always fun to watch.
    Thanks again to all our rescue support from the BWA and the local folks. Barry Grimes and John Mello are putting together a video from all the combined footage, stay tuned for that at this year’s NPFF in Lexington. Thanks also to Matt Delong for helping us with the start times, Whitewater Warehouse for one of the trophies, Eric Henrickson for the bibs, and Teamscum for some extra prizes. The party was great once again, with a nice fireworks display, a shoeless drunk running through the fire, kick-ass bluegrass music and some belly-dancing.  
    Results are listed below, and on the website soon. See you next year!

1. Toby MacDermott        Remix 100%        10:27
2. Geoff Calhoun        T-Canyon                10:28
3. Matt Walker                T-Slalom                10:43
4. Adam Herzog        Remix 100%        10:44
5. Bryan Kirk            WS Excel                10:48
6. Eric Henrickson        Mirage            10:51
6. John Grace            Remix 100%        10:51  
8. Julian Campbell        Tornado                10:53
9. Jay Ditty            New Wave                10:57  C-1
10. Eric Chance                Tornado                11:09
11. Jason Hale            WS Momentum         11:10
12. Howard Tidwell        Spirit                    11:13  (swam the finish line!)
13. Caleb Paquette        Tornado                11:19
13. Andrew Austell        Corsica                  11:19
15. Paul Stamilio        Tornado                11:20
16. Jay Moffatt                Tornado                  11:25
17. Isaac Ludwig        Dancer            11:27
18. Eric Strittmater        Tornado                11:33
19. Gifford Sanders        Crossfire                  11:49
20. Luke Hopkins        Dancer            11:52
21. Brian Jennings        New Wave Quest    12:04
22. Nate Helms                Tornado bitch        12:06
23. Robin Betz                Remix 100%        12:09  W
24. Will Lyons                Cascade                12:10  C-1
25. Clay Warren        Response                12:12
26. Jason Parker        Tornado                  12:28
27. Matt Delong        Vortex            12:34
28. Brian Mattingly        Jefe Grande        13:02
28. Mark Miller                Burn                    13:02
30. Jon Crain            Jefe                    13:05
31. Brad Buddenburg    Crossfire                  13:08
32. Josh Burton                Habitat 80                13:13
33. Kirk Williams        Tornado                 13:18  Hand-paddle
34. Matt Rudolph        Jefe                    14:46
35. Katie Buddenburg    Mamba                17:33  W (w/ a brief interruption)
